About BC Workinfonet and ASPECT

BC Workinfonet Mission:

To provide unemployed and other individuals who are making career, learning and work transitions throughout British Columbia, and those who work with them, with relevant, accessible and up-to-date electronic labour market information and related services..

About BC Workinfonet

BC Workinfonet achieves its mission through the development and maintenance of a virtual information centre that provides access to career, learning and employment information resources and services such as labour market information website indexes, job listings, work search tutorials, career event calendars and practitioner listservs that British Columbians can use in order to prepare for, obtain and keep employment. Services are provided in English and French and targeted to both adults and youth in the Province.

About ASPECT

The Association of Service Providers for Employability and Career Training (ASPECT) is a non-profit association of community-based trainers that collectively strive to prepare people for the world of work. Our members are leading experts in the delivery of career training programs that lead to improved chances of employability and job retention.
The goal of community-based training is to assist all clients in their efforts to become employable—get people working in their own communities and provide them with relevant skills for the future.
ASPECT has undertaken the managment of BC Workinfonet to help individuals who are looking for work and to support career practitioners across BC.

EDUCACENTRE College and “Info-Emploi C.B.”

 

Éducacentre College is responsible for the maintenance of the site, “Info-Emploi BC” and its monthly news, the home page and the list of upcoming events. 

 

OUR INSTITUTION

 Éducacentre College, the only French-speaking College of the province of British Columbia, offers post-secondary courses in French in its four campuses of Vancouver, Victoria, Prince George and Nanaimo.  The virtual College allows more adults to follow self-paced studies in the comfort of their own homes. Online courses to date include: Administration, Business, Computer Training, Early Childhood Education, Health Care, Hospitality, Media and Tourism.
